Pilot plant extraction of hafnium from zirconium
Zirconium has been used as a structural material in nuclear reactors because of its corrosion resistance, high-temperature strength, and low neutron absorption.

ODS EUROFER Steel Strengthened by Y-(Ce, Hf, La, Sc, and Zr) Complex Oxides
Oxide dispersion-strengthened (ODS) materials contain homogeneous dispersions of temperature-stable nano-oxides serving as obstacles for dislocations and further pinning of grain boundaries.

Review of processes for the production of hafnium-free zirconium.
The three main industrial processes for the production of hafnium-free zirconium are described in terms of their head-end, zirconium-hafnium separation and zirconium metal forming steps.
